Bee-eaters are some of the most erratic, and extremely fast flyers because their food source is insects which they catch on the wing, in mid-air. It is extremely difficult to capture a mid-air contact between a bee-eater and its prey, but fortunately they do have a habit of returning to the same perch when hunting in an area which helps a little... Because they very often will catch insects such a bees, which have a sting, they more often than not, will catch the insect then beat it to death or to get rid of the sting, before they swally them whole. This was a Little Bee-eater, who was in the process of catching a fly just before beating and swallowing it.
